Transaction 57869541cfe53a83a94cc60a1de4822b55d392d9a5d26ff98a4c54eadd002834
1 Input
1 Output
-
57869541cfe53a83a94cc60a1de4822b55d392d9a5d26ff98a4c54eadd002834:0
- value
- 1795218
- script pubkey
- OP_0 OP_PUSHBYTES_20 8abfcd19b5b84d56ed01fe42d13ade1878049dae
- address
- bc1q32lu6xd4hpx4dmgplepdzwk7rpuqf8dwxv7dal